Output 6af28ef51783aaf930f0c8027ea77839201d1bcc712d5d7cd9f3149dea67da9f:1

value
1538268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19498389421090e17892c9fb71b1b5446fadd500 OP_EQUAL
address
33zitAk678gmNBtwmo3BEq6tFmyEgDVqLu
transaction
6af28ef51783aaf930f0c8027ea77839201d1bcc712d5d7cd9f3149dea67da9f
spent
true